本地搭建直播服务器如何优化性能?
随着互联网的快速发展,直播行业日益繁荣。为了满足用户对直播服务的需求,本地搭建直播服务器成为了一种趋势。然而,如何优化直播服务器的性能,成为了一个亟待解决的问题。本文将为您详细介绍本地搭建直播服务器如何优化性能。
一、服务器硬件配置
- CPU:选择高性能的CPU,如Intel Xeon系列,能够提高直播服务器的处理速度。
- 内存:根据直播业务需求,合理配置内存大小,一般建议4GB以上。
- 硬盘:选用SSD硬盘,提高读写速度,降低延迟。
- 网络:采用千兆以太网,确保网络传输稳定。
二、服务器软件优化
- 操作系统:选择稳定、高效的操作系统,如CentOS、Ubuntu等。
- 直播软件:选择性能优秀的直播软件,如OBS、Nginx等。
- 服务器配置:合理配置服务器参数,如开启TCP加速、优化防火墙规则等。
三、网络优化
- 带宽:根据直播业务需求,合理配置带宽,确保直播流畅。
- CDN:使用CDN技术,将直播内容分发到全球各地的节点,降低延迟。
- 负载均衡:采用负载均衡技术,将用户请求分发到不同的服务器,提高服务器性能。
四、内容优化
- 视频编码:选择合适的视频编码格式,如H.264、H.265等,降低带宽消耗。
- 分辨率:根据用户需求,合理设置直播分辨率,避免过高消耗服务器资源。
- 帧率:合理设置直播帧率,如30fps、60fps等,保证直播画面流畅。
案例分析
某直播平台在本地搭建直播服务器时,采用了以下优化措施:
- 服务器硬件:选用Intel Xeon CPU、16GB内存、SSD硬盘、千兆以太网。
- 服务器软件:使用CentOS操作系统、OBS直播软件。
- 网络优化:采用CDN技术、负载均衡技术。
- 内容优化:采用H.264编码、1080p分辨率、60fps帧率。
经过优化后,该直播平台的直播流畅度、稳定性得到了显著提升,用户满意度大幅提高。
总之,本地搭建直播服务器优化性能是一个系统工程,需要从硬件、软件、网络、内容等多个方面进行综合考虑。通过合理配置、优化,可以有效提高直播服务器的性能,为用户提供优质的直播体验。
猜你喜欢:im出海